Worn down and dirty apartment
Location
We arrived at a dirty and worn down apartment with a thick layer of dust. The couch was covered with a blanket full of dog hair, and when we removed the blacket, it revealed a massively stained couch. Previous reviews mention the same couch, so they are aware. Even the dinner table had dog hairs on it. The information folder had a WhatsApp number directly to the cleaning lady, so it is expected that guests send complaints directly to her. As guests, we should not have to complain to anyone other than the host - It should not be our responsibility to call anyone about their work effort. Instead we spent the first 2 hours on a Saturday night cleaning the apartment, and buying a new blanket, so we could actually use the couch. Plates, glasses and cutlery are placed in an old cupboard in the living room, so everything stinks of the old closet. There was one roll of toilet paper for two people for 7 nights, as well as one single tea towel. Electric wires in the bathroom were connected with tape. The bed sagged in the middle, so it was impossible to sleep on each side of the bed. Old water damage marks on the wall in the living room. When we were about to check out, the key box was gone. Had to call customer service multiple times, and wait an hour before we got a new address 3km from the apartment, where we could drop off the key.
